Doug Paul, LPC, LMHC, LCPC, QS, CPCS has been working as a clinician with substance use disorders since 2007. He completed a Bachelor of Arts from the University of Central Florida in 2002. He went on to complete a Master of Science in Rehabilitation Counseling from Georgia State University in 2007. During his graduate training, he participated in and presented university-sponsored research findings at the American Counseling Association’s Annual Convention in Montreal, Quebec; going on to present at over 37 professional conferences over the next 18 years. While at two nationally recognized treatment programs in Georgia and Florida from 2007-2020, he gained skills in both clinical and leadership acumen. In private practice for the past five years, he continues to provide therapy, consultation, and supervision. Doug continues to practice his own recovery program, which he has been doing for the last 25 years.
